Hi Nige,
The mark should read 'Danielo'. Don't know the maker, but possible Choisy-le-Roi. I've seen this model quite a few times, but don't know much about Danielo. Like Ferjac, CLA & Cesari it's one of those names that turns up on nice quality animal figures, but there's not much written about it...

If you mean the model shown below, then definitely Feigl & Morawetz, Libochovice.
Marcus identified it a while back, they are available with or without frosting to the bears. Produced from the 30s to 90s but the earlier ones have better mould quality.
